Mountain biking around Senterada offers diverse terrain at the foot of the Catalan Pyrenees, characterized by significant elevation changes and scenic landscapes. The region features the lush Fosca Valley, with the Flamisell and Sarroca rivers adding to its natural beauty. Riders can expect a mix of mountain paths, forested areas, and routes that traverse small villages, providing varied riding experiences. This area is known for its well-established trail networks, catering to a wide range of skill levels.

Sas is a village in the municipality of Sarroca de Bellera, in the Pallars Jussà region. The site of Sas has been documented since 887, when it is mentioned in a document from the monastery of Santa Maria de Lavaix, and is documented again in 986 and 1024. These documents speak of the place and the castle of Sas. There are no remains of the castle. In 1994 it had only one resident, but in 2005 it had 4 again. The "Font de Cantoria" spring is somewhat hidden, but right in town, but there is also a drinking water point in the middle of town.

Senterada offers a wide network of over 40 mountain bike trails. These routes cater to various skill levels, from gentle rides to challenging excursions through the Pyrenean landscape.
Yes, Senterada provides a diverse range of trails suitable for all abilities. You'll find 7 easy routes for beginners or those seeking a relaxed ride, 17 moderate trails for intermediate riders, and 21 difficult routes for experienced mountain bikers looking for a challenge.
The terrain around Senterada is highly varied, reflecting its position at the foot of the Catalan Pyrenees. Riders can expect significant elevation changes, from river valleys like the Fosca Valley to mountain passes. Trails often traverse lush forests, small villages, and offer stunning views of the Pyrenean peaks. You might encounter a mix of mountain paths and more established routes.
For a moderate challenge, consider the Pobla de Segur – Claverol Castle loop from la Pobla de Segur. This 28.5-mile (46 km) route takes approximately 2 hours 37 minutes to complete and features an elevation gain of around 765 meters, offering rewarding views without being overly strenuous.
Yes, many routes in the Senterada area are designed as loops. For example, the Salàs de Pallars y Ermita de Sant Salvador de Toralla — Circular por el Pallars Jussà desde La Pobla de Segur is a popular circular trail that offers a challenging ride through the Pallars Jussà region.
While exploring the trails, you can discover several natural highlights. These include the serene Lake Montcortés and the unique natural monument of Font de la O. You might also encounter impressive mountain passes like the Climb to Collado del Triador and Coll d'Oli, offering breathtaking views.
Absolutely. Senterada's region is rich in history and culture. You can visit the charming Salàs de Pallars Historic Village, known for its character. The area also features historical churches like Santa Coloma de Bruguet and the remains of Romanesque monasteries such as Santa Grata de Senterada and Sant Ginés de Bellera, providing interesting stops during your ride.
The mountain biking experience in Senterada is high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.5 stars from over 70 reviews. Riders often praise the diverse Pyrenean landscapes, the scenic river valleys, and the varied mountain terrain that offers options for all ability levels.
Yes, Senterada offers options for families. While many trails involve significant elevation, there are 7 easy routes that are generally more suitable for families or those with less experience. These routes provide a gentler introduction to mountain biking amidst the beautiful Pyrenean scenery.
The region is generally excellent for outdoor activities. Spring and autumn are often ideal, with pleasant temperatures and vibrant natural colors. Autumn is particularly popular for its lush forests and mushroom picking, adding to the scenic beauty. Summer can also be good, especially at higher elevations, but be prepared for warmer temperatures in the valleys.
Senterada is part of larger, renowned mountain bike networks. It's included in routes like Pedals de Foc, which encircles the Aigüestortes i Estany de Sant Maurici National Park, and sections of the Transpyr, a cross-Pyrenees route. These offer opportunities for multi-day adventures.
